Ep 28: The Unique Challenges of Maintaining AI Systems and Ensuring Accuracy

from The Fourth Industrial Revolution and 100 Years of AI (1950-2050) · host Scry AI

Exploring "The Fourth Industrial Revolution and 100 Years of AI" by Dr. Alok Aggarwal, we dive into the intricate world of AI system maintenance, uncovering the critical challenges of keeping artificial intelligence accurate and relevant. From understanding why AI systems require frequent rebuilding to exploring the complex reasons behind performance deterioration, we'll unpack the often-overlooked landscape of Machine Learning Operations (MLOps). Why do seemingly sophisticated AI systems need constant reinvention, and what does this tell us about the nature of artificial intelligence?
